Elementary Education (Kindergarten – Grade II)
Building Foundations with Joy, Curiosity, and Care
At DCM YES, our Elementary Education program—spanning Kindergarten to Grade II—is designed to nurture young minds through a blend of structured learning and joyful exploration. Rooted in the CBSE curriculum and aligned with the principles of the National Education Policy (NEP) 2020, our early years pedagogy emphasizes holistic development, foundational literacy and numeracy, and the cultivation of social-emotional skills.
We believe that the early years are not just a prelude to formal schooling—they are the most critical phase in shaping a child’s lifelong love for learning.
📚 Pedagogical Approach: Playful, Purposeful, and Progressive
Our classrooms are vibrant spaces where children learn through:
- Play-Based Learning: Activities that stimulate imagination, motor skills, and cognitive growth.
- Experiential & Inquiry-Based Methods: Encouraging children to ask questions, explore materials, and discover concepts organically.
- Integrated Themes: Concepts are taught through cross-curricular themes that connect language, math, science, and the arts.
- Multisensory Instruction: Use of visuals, sounds, movement, and tactile experiences to support diverse learning styles.
- Social-Emotional Development: Daily routines and interactions that build empathy, confidence, and collaboration.
The curriculum focuses on foundational skills in English, Mathematics, Environmental Awareness, and General Knowledge, while also introducing children to creative arts, physical education, and values education.
🎨 Learning Experiences: Inside and Outside the Classroom
Our young learners engage in a wide range of activities that make learning meaningful, memorable, and fun:
🏫 In-Class Activities
- Storytelling & Puppet Shows: Enhancing language skills and imagination.
- Math Manipulatives & Games: Building number sense and logical thinking.
- Circle Time Discussions: Developing listening, sharing, and emotional expression.
- Art & Craft Projects: Encouraging creativity and fine motor development.
- Rhymes, Songs & Movement: Supporting auditory learning and rhythm.
🌳 Outdoor & Experiential Learning
- Nature Walks & Garden Time: Observing seasons, plants, and animals in real life.
- Sensory Play Zones: Sand, water, and texture-based activities for tactile exploration.
- Field Visits: Age-appropriate excursions to farms, museums, or local landmarks.
- Celebration of Festivals & Theme Days: Building cultural awareness and joy in community.
- Physical Education & Yoga: Promoting health, coordination, and mindfulness.
